What to Look for in Primary Care Services in Colorado Springs

Choosing a primary care provider is a personal decision. You want more than a convenient location or a quick appointment. You want a healthcare professional who takes the time to understand your concerns and works with you toward practical health goals.

A strong primary care experience should include preventive care, routine health evaluations, treatment for common illnesses, and ongoing support when you are managing a chronic condition. It can also be helpful when one provider can address different stages and areas of healthcare rather than making every concern feel like a separate process.

Communication matters, too. When you feel comfortable discussing your symptoms, lifestyle, medications, and concerns, it becomes easier to have meaningful conversations about your health and treatment options.

Preventive Care Is an Important Part of Primary Healthcare

Many people associate healthcare with treating illness, but prevention deserves just as much attention. Regular visits can provide an opportunity to discuss health concerns, monitor changes, review risk factors, and stay on top of appropriate screenings.

Preventive care may look different for every person. Age, medical history, family history, lifestyle, and existing health concerns can all influence what healthcare discussions are appropriate.

Having an established primary care relationship also means you have a familiar place to turn when questions arise. Instead of waiting until a minor concern becomes difficult to manage, you can discuss it with a provider and determine what steps may be appropriate.

Support for Chronic Health Conditions

Living with a chronic health condition can require consistency. Conditions such as high blood pressure, diabetes, or other long-term concerns may involve regular monitoring, lifestyle adjustments, medications, and follow-up care.

Primary care can help bring these pieces together. A provider who knows your history can better understand changes over time and help you stay engaged with your care plan.

What does a primary care provider do?

A primary care provider helps patients with routine healthcare, preventive services, common illnesses, ongoing health concerns, and management of chronic conditions. They can also help determine when additional medical evaluation or specialty care may be appropriate.

How often should I visit a primary care provider?

The appropriate frequency depends on your age, health history, risk factors, current conditions, and healthcare needs. Your provider can recommend a schedule that is appropriate for you.

Can primary care help with chronic conditions?

Yes. Primary care commonly includes ongoing management of chronic health conditions. Regular follow-ups can help patients and providers monitor health changes and adjust care plans when appropriate.
